Hotels near National Gallery London
Back to: National Gallery London | Greater London Hotels
Click on 'More info' to see more pictures and to check availability on any of our listed National Gallery London hotels. Click 'Add to favourites' to store any of the National Gallery London hotels for later viewing.
National Gallery London Hotels

Knaresborough Boutique Apartments
Located in London, the Knaresborough Boutique Apartment offers self-catering accommodations with free WiFi access in a historic Victorian building. The Royal Albert Hall is just 1 miles away and Earl's Court Underground Station is a 4 minutes' walk and is served by the District and Piccadil..
Location: London, Greater London, England (2.9 miles, 4.7 km, direction W)
More info |
Add to favourites

O'Gradys Guesthouse Ilford
You're eligible for a Genius discount at Mccafferty's Guesthouse Ilford Formerly O'Grady's! To save at this property, all you have to do is sign in. A 3-minute drive from the center of Ilford, McCafferty's Guest house provides comfortable rooms and an Irish bar with live entertainment at the w..
Location: Ilford, Greater London, England (10.6 miles, 17.1 km, direction NE)
More info |
Add to favourites

Lyttleton Lodge
You're eligible for a Genius discount at Lyttleton Lodge! To save at this property, all you have to do is sign in. Ideal for both business and holidaying travelers, Lyttleton Lodge guest house offers clean, relaxing and quiet accommodations. Rooms come with free Wi-Fi, a TV, tea and coffee making f..
Location: Uxbridge, Greater London, England (15.2 miles, 24.4 km, direction W)
More info |
Add to favourites

The Kings Arms
The Kings Arms is located in London, a 7 minute walk from Ealing Broadway underground station. It offers a restaurant and bar, with darts and a games room. The restaurant offers a pool table and TVs with live sport. The bedrooms have a private entrance, an en suite and flat-screen TVs. Free WiFi is..
Location: London, Greater London, England (7.5 miles, 12.1 km, direction W)
More info |
Add to favouritesNational Gallery London Hotels
Greater London Hotels
Other popular nearby attractions for Hotels
Shakespeares Globe Theatre hotels Eltham Palace hotels Lullingstone Country Park hotels Sevenoaks Wildfowl Reserve hotels Kensington Palace hotels Berkhamsted Castle hotels Rothamsted Park hotels Earl's Court Exhibition Centre hotels Claremont Landscape Garden hotels Hatchlands Park hotels